Trump set to make millions by renaming Florida airport after himself

In a move that blends civic infrastructure with the high-stakes world of private branding, Palm Beach International Airport is on the verge of a historic identity shift. Following a razor-thin 4-3 vote by the Palm Beach County Commission on Tuesday, the facility is slated to be rechristened the President Donald J. Trump International Airport—a transition that carries far more weight than a mere change in signage. The rebranding, mandated by legislation recently signed into law by Florida Governor Ron DeSantis, is scheduled to take effect on July 1…
